Job Description

Community Healthcare of Texas has provided Hospice and Palliative Care Services since 1996. Community Healthcare of Texas has cared for patients with serious and terminal illnesses throughout North Central Texas. Providing compassionate care for those living with an illness while supporting those caring for a loved one is the mission of CommunityHealthcare of Texas.

Community Healthcare of Texas is currently recruiting for a Triage Team Assistant.
POSITION SUMMARY
Provide administrative support to the Triage department.
ESSENTIAL
FUNCTIONSSupports the role of the Triage RN by attending to non-medical phone calls consisting of DME needs, staff ETAs, and scheduling. Collaborates with the RN triage and call teams to assist with scheduling visits to field staff. Responds to DME needs by scheduling deliveries and pickups for all patients. Attends to inquiries received via fax, email, and phone. Communicates directly with individuals and families to provide information about eligibility requirements, application details, payment methods, and applicants' legal rights during intake assessment. Provide effective communication to patients, staff members, other health care professionals, and referral sources. Perform mi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ned.
POSITION QUALIFICATIONS
High School diploma required (Some college preferred)1+ year experience in a clerical settingExperience in a healthcare settingTyping and PC skills requiredReasonable Accommodations Statement To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. Reasonable Acc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Open shifts from 5:00pm-9:00pm on weeknights or open shifts during the day on weekends.
